Yes: As your baby begins to walk and seems to understand the word "no, " it is easy to expect too much from them. The toddler uses "no" to express anything from "let me think about it" to "i don't want to." try to show baby what you expect them to do, don't just tell them. Standing a child in a corner for a minute time out will often break up a recurring behavior problem.
